"Ken Anderson" > wrote:

> Mine's ATC. Stood in the garage and calibrated at probably 60 ambient. In
> any event, I doubt you'd get a difference of 1.5 to 2.0 due to poor
> calibration. Could my chintzy refractometer be that inaccurate? Do folks
> ever take their refractometers with them to the juicehouse, so as to check
> the Brix for themselves?


'Twas just a suggestion. In a recent thread, someone complained about an
even larger discrepancy between the refractometer and hydrometer readings,
and (lack of proper) calibration was one of the possibilities cited.

I have no experience with "juicehouses", but I know that by the time I get
my grapes home from the vineyard (about a two hour drive in hot weather),
they are always consistently lower by 2-3º Brix from that claimed by the
grower --- and I know him to be an honest person. I have no explanation for
this, except that I use a cheap hydrometer and he uses a (very expensive)
refractometer.
